From Ranger:
Ranger's Texture Paste in Opaque Crackle- This stuff is fabulous, and needs no undercoating to work. It doesn't flake or crack off , and excepts color mediums wonderfully.

From Tim:
The Distress Oxides are a must have...the opaqueness of pigment and translucency of dye ink all rolled into one, and with the help of water the oxide look we all try for using a number of products, but with this only one product is needed. LOVE that!

From Dina
Her new Media Journal is way too cool with pages of burlap, heavy cotton paper, and canvas. So many people came to thumb through her sample. I can see this becoming an artsy scrapbook easily.
Scribble Sticks are a fun new pigment option. You can color straight from them, water color with them, and they even write on wet mediums..a big plus.
